Newman PhonePC: A computer that looks like a phone

Posted in PCs by Conner Flynn on June 6th, 2010

Beijing-based company Newman has been busy showing off a computer that looks like a landline telephone set at Taipei Computex 2010. It’s called the PhonePC, and the device features an AMD Sempron processor with an AMD M690E/ SB600 chipset and ATI Radeon X1250 graphics.

Sadly that’s all the info we have. Nothing on price or availability yet. But if you want a computer that looks like a phone, this is for you.
